Getting to Know the Principles of Power-Efficient Climate Control
While you might think that turning up the air conditioner is the only way to cool your living space during summer, learning about the basics of energy-efficient cooling offers a different view. It's not only about comfort, it's additionally about energy conservation. Keep in mind that cooling techniques like ventilation, insulation, and shading can substantially lower your energy usage. By adding proper insulation, you're preventing cool air from seeping away, thereby reducing the need to continuously run your AC. Shading your windows, especially those in direct sunlight, can minimize heat buildup. And ventilation, whether passive or powered, helps promote airflow, maintaining cooler temperatures. A more energy-efficient home isn't merely budget-friendly, it's eco-friendly too.
Selecting the Best Air Conditioner
Having knowledge of energy-saving cooling techniques is a great foundation. But selecting the proper air conditioning system is crucial to maximize these strategies. Deciding between central and ductless requires careful thought. Central systems cool your entire home, while ductless systems target individual zones. Each type has its advantages, but ductless installations typically use less power if some areas are used less frequently. Check the energy ratings when selecting a system. Superior ratings show greater efficiency, but may cost more initially. It requires careful consideration, but choosing an energy-efficient system will save money long-term. Remember, the appropriate system helps manage that Southern Utah heat effectively.
The Significance of Home Insulation in Cooling Your Living Space
Although it may not be the first thing you think about, proper insulation serves an essential role in maintaining comfortable temperatures during the summer season. Insulation materials work by providing thermal resistance, decreasing the rate of heat transfer from your home's interior to the warm environment outside. This means that the cooler air produced by your air conditioning system is retained more effectively, reducing the strain on your AC unit and lowering your expenses on energy bills. It's important to select insulation with a high R-value, which demonstrates greater thermal resistance. From fiberglass to spray foam, the right insulation can make a substantial improvement in your home's summer comfort and energy performance.

Optimizing Cross-Ventilation Advantages
To fully harness the effectiveness of natural ventilation, it's crucial to maximize airflow advantages. This requires carefully positioned windows and implementing cross ventilation methods. When installing windows, choose those that face opposite directions. This establishes a route for air to pass through across your home, providing natural temperature control.
Additionally, you can improve this airflow by keeping open adjacent windows. This creates a cross breeze that can greatly reduce indoor temperatures. To maximize the results, make certain that the windows are free from blockages, both inside and outside, such as furniture or plants. By monitoring these aspects, you're optimizing natural ventilation and decreasing your need on energy-intensive cooling systems.
Nighttime Ventilation Strategy
Although hot summer days may be scorching, nighttime usually bring a revitalizing coolness you can use effectively. Here's where a nighttime ventilation approach proves useful. By harnessing the advantage of natural ventilation, you can achieve effective nighttime cooling and increased air circulation.
Initiate by unlocking windows and doors as soon as the outside temperature drops below the inside temperature. This encourages cool air to come inside and force the warm air out, establishing a natural air circulation. Then, as daybreak comes and the temperature climbs, close everything up to keep the cool air inside. Applying this basic but efficient strategy can create a substantial difference in maintaining a comfortable and energy-efficient home during the scorching Southern Utah summers.

Improving AC Performance
To make sure your AC functions at optimal levels, regular maintenance must be a key consideration. Failing to do this can lead to lower effectiveness and increasing bills. Prevent this from occurring. AC optimization strategies include regularly maintaining filters, ensuring your system isn't working harder than necessary.
Cooling system upgrades are highly beneficial. Using a programmable thermostat allows you to customize cooling times, saving energy while you're away. You should also think about fixing leaky ductwork. Unsealed ducts may lose as much as 30% of your AC's efficiency.
To ensure optimal AC performance, it's essential to stay on top of maintenance and consider system enhancement options. You'll enjoy better indoor comfort and more manageable energy costs this summer.

Smart Landscaping Strategies for Enhanced Cooling and Energy Savings
While a smart thermostat remains an impressive way of controlling energy use in your home, another effective method can be found in smart landscaping. Strategically placing shade trees along the south and west sides of your home can decrease your air conditioning needs substantially. These natural shade providers function as natural barriers against the sun's heat, promoting outdoor cooling.
You might want to include xeriscaping plants into your yard. These drought-tolerant species require minimal water, helping save this valuable resource. Furthermore, their capability to flourish in hot conditions contributes to a more pleasant setting.
Lastly, avoid using highly absorbent materials for patios or walkways. Select reflective surfaces as an alternative. They bounce back the sun's rays, helping decrease heat around your home and improving your energy efficiency.

How Does Humidity Impact Energy Efficiency in Cooling Across Southern Utah?
Humidity has a significant impact on how efficiently your cooling system operates. When the air is humid, your system works harder to cool it, resulting in increased energy consumption. As a result, using a dehumidifier will make your AC's job easier and reduce your energy costs.
What Are Some Eco-Friendly Substitutes for Air Conditioning?
Think about ceiling fans and evaporative coolers as energy-efficient alternatives to traditional AC. These options are efficient, use minimal energy, and lower your environmental impact. It's an efficient, economical option for keeping your Southern Utah home cool.
